Fólk recruitment has been asked to partner exclusively with a leading FMCG organisation who are looking to appoint a new Group Head of Recruitment. This is a newly created role and will work closely with the HR Director to lead on the group wide recruitment strategy, and subsequently support in the delivery of the newly created people strategy. As the Group Head of Recruitment you will be given the opportunity to shape the future of talent acquisition across multiple sites in the UK, with a specific focus on the organisation becoming an Employer of Choice. Key responsibilities include:

Collaborating with the HR Director to align recruitment strategies with organisational goals. Managing and mentoring site-based hiring managers to enhance their recruitment capabilities. Conducting in-depth evaluations of existing recruitment processes to identify strengths and areas for development. Building and nurturing talent pools to ensure a steady pipeline of qualified candidates. Developing and executing initiatives to position the organisation as an employer of choice. Conducting a full audit of current recruitment processes and subsequently implementing appropriate changes that drive efficiencies & ensure a consistent approach to recruitment across all their UK Manufacturing sites. The ideal candidate will possess: Extensive experience in recruitment, preferably within the FMCG industry. Proven leadership skills with the ability to inspire and guide a diverse team. Strong analytical abilities to assess and refine recruitment processes.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ills to build relationships at all levels. A strategic mindset with a focus on long-term talent acquisition goals.
